The Tinto hitmaker managed to win the Best Newcomer award at the BOMU awards but this will even be a tougher one for Motsetserepa because he is nominated in the best international act category alongside American music giants such as Drake and Kanye West. The Best International Act is a category which was introduced this year to celebrate the 10th edition of the event alongside another new category, Artist of the Decade.

After a successful run last year, SAHHAs returns with what has been dubbed as "The Manifesto" which is the theme for this year. The show will boast a number of appearances, live performances and tributes by today’s leading musicians within the Hip Hop culture and will be aired on SABC 1 on December 4, 2021.

SAHHAs is the year's biggest celebration of hip hop on the African continent and this year is no different as it will showcase those who stood above the rest with their artistic innovation and further defined their careers through what has been the toughest year for artists all across the globe. Motsetserepa is one of the nominees who were selected from more than 2,000 submissions across 24 categories. Voting opened on Wednesday and will close on Friday, November 26, 2021.

Motsetserepa’s debut album Willian catapulted him to music success specifically his video Tinto which broke the Internet when it was released last year. The artist, whose real name is Bofelo William Molebatsi, is one of the most followed public figure on social media in Botswana with over two million followers. Motseretserepa has been working between SA and Botswana to push his brand. He recently released amazing visuals of his song titled Heavenly Sent featuring Mpho Sebina.

Even though he has not won a Grammy, Motsetserepa’s video is a concept depicting his performance after winning a Grammy which is the international music industry's highest honour. Thanks to the video clip of Motsetserepa singing American megastar Chris Brown’s "Don't Wake Me Up" last year, the comedian and rapper spread across social media and catapulted him to international stardom.
